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Lavadora y Secadora en el código postal 48326

Cuál es el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ora más barato en 48326?

Actualmente el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ora más accequible en 48326 está en Evergreen Apartments listado en $1,249.

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ora en 48326?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ora en 48326 es $2,016.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ora más grande en 48326?

A día de hoy el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ora y más metros cuadrados en 48326 una unidad de 1,782 a partir de $1,879 en Arcadia.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ora en 48326?

El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ora en 48326 es actualmente de 674 sq ft.
